Bernice (Bernie) was born June 17, 1925 near Wolford, ND to Jerry P and Catherine (Gingerich) Yoder. She attended country school in the Wolford area. She started working out of the home at age 13. Bernie worked in various positions in the Wolford, Rugby, and Minot ND areas – and also in Wichita, KS. In 1948 Bernie attended short-term at Hesston Bible College, Hesston, Ks.
In 1950 Bernie entered Mennonite Voluntary Service (VS) in Kansas City, KS and spent 2 years working in the Kansas City General Hospital. While in VS she met Albert Erb, Jr, who also participated in VS. They were married August 1, 1953 in Kansas City. They began their married life in Beemer, NE, eventually moving to the Wisner area.
Bernie cared for her family and home and helped in the family businesses. In later years she also worked for Kruse’s IGA, Jack and Jill, Rainbow Lanes, Marilyn’s Tea Room, West Point Garden Center and Woodland Circle in Wisner.
Bernie especially enjoyed time with children, grandchildren and the extended family. She loved attending all her grandchildren’s events and being a part of their lives. Favorite memories of the grandchildren are pancake breakfasts, chocolate chip cookies and jumping on the trampoline with grandma. Another joy was her lawn and flower gardens. Many hours were spent working outside – family greatly appreciated the peace and beauty of the homeplace. In her late 80’s she could be found outside mowing and tending her flower gardens. Inside activities included crocheting, basket making and reading.
Bernie accepted Christ as a teenager and was baptized at Lakeview Mennonite Church, Wolford ND. She was an active member of Beemer Mennonite Church. She enjoyed being on the Flower and Food Committees and participating in the Sewing Circle.
Bernie and Al moved to Elkhorn Valley Apartments in 2016. Their last 2 years were spent at Colonial Haven in Beemer NE.
